Geolocation Technology

Geolocation technology uses a combination of methods to determine a device’s location, including cell tower triangulation, Wi-Fi fingerprinting, and GPS signals. This technology allows spatial searches to pinpoint a user’s location within a specific area. The accuracy of geolocation can vary depending on factors such as the device’s proximity to cell towers and the availability of GPS signals.

  • Cell Tower Triangulation: This method involves using the signals from multiple cell towers to determine a device’s location. By measuring the time delay between when a signal is sent and when it is received, geolocation can estimate the device’s distance from each tower.
  • Wi-Fi Fingerprinting: This method involves collecting data on the Wi-Fi signals in a specific area and creating a database of unique signal patterns. When a device connects to a Wi-Fi network, geolocation can match the signal pattern to the pre-existing data and estimate the device’s location.
  • GPS Signals: GPS satellites transmit signals that contain location information. By receiving these signals and measuring the time delay, geolocation can estimate a device’s location.

IP Mapping, Monro near me

IP mapping involves mapping an IP address to a specific physical location. This is typically done by analyzing the IP address and determining the location of the internet service provider (ISP) that allocated the IP address. While IP mapping is not as accurate as geolocation, it can provide a coarse estimate of a user’s location.

  • IP Address: Each device connected to the internet has a unique IP address. By analyzing the IP address, IP mapping can determine the location of the device.
  • ISP Data: ISPs typically store data on the IP addresses they allocate to customers. By accessing this data, IP mapping can determine the location of the device.

GPS Technology

GPS technology involves using a network of satellites orbiting the Earth to provide location information. By receiving signals from multiple satellites, a device can estimate its location using trilateration.

  • Satellite Network: The GPS network consists of a constellation of satellites orbiting the Earth. Each satellite transmits signals that contain location information.
  • Signal Reception: A device receives signals from multiple satellites and measures the time delay between when the signal is sent and when it is received.
  • Trilateration: By measuring the time delay and the distance between the device and each satellite, GPS can estimate the device’s location.
